Summary
The documentation shows minor Windows bias. It references Windows-specific tools (Windows File Explorer, WSUS), and mentions Azure PowerShell as a method to create certificates before any Linux alternatives. Screenshots of downloaded certificates are shown in Windows File Explorer, and examples of certificate creation are linked to PowerShell and a Readiness Checker tool, with no mention of Linux/macOS CLI alternatives (e.g., OpenSSL). However, the main workflow is via a web UI, which is platform-agnostic, and no critical steps are Windows-only.
Recommendations
  • Add explicit instructions or examples for creating certificates using Linux/macOS tools such as OpenSSL.
  • Include screenshots of certificate downloads in Linux/macOS environments (e.g., Nautilus, Finder) alongside Windows File Explorer.
  • Mention Linux/macOS equivalents for referenced Windows tools (e.g., alternatives to WSUS, PowerShell).
  • Clarify that the web UI is accessible from any OS/browser and that the certificate management process is cross-platform.
  • Provide links to Linux/macOS certificate management documentation where appropriate.
